    Same issue here, Apple M1 + Fusion for ARM exp version + Kali MareMetal Installer - VM 2CPU 4096Gmem 40G. After installation (choosing either with or without tools), good on first boot, then did sudo apt update (no problem if reboot from this point), sudo apt upgrade -y , sudo reboot, problem happened, booting stuck by display Loading RamDisk.

    Share here, a workaround, don't need to reinstall.
    During booting, select Advanced Options, choose third options there to boot "Kali linux 5.16.0 kali7 arm64". It will go.
    Then, should every time to choose Advance Options? I installed "sudo su" "grub-customizer" (yes to install), then edit the first boot menu content to be the same the third option of Advanced. Save/Reboot. It goes.

    I don't know what is the problem of new Kali linux 5.18.0 kali5 arm64. Wish kali expertise to support.

    Your workaround is correct.

    The issue is that VMWare Fusion has a bug that makes it incompatible with the 5.18 kernel, and while we were reverting it in 5.16 and 5.17, it's no longer feasible for us to do so. We've been in contact with VMWare about getting an update out, but unfortunately, there is nothing we can do in Kali about this, and have to wait for VMWare to push out a build with the fix in it.

    VMWare just release a new version - this should fix the problem (hopefully)
    I'm testing it right now - will update if I can successfully boot kernel 5.18 or not

    https://blogs.vmware.com/teamfusion/...h-preview.html

    Edit: Happy to see that kernel 5.18 can successfully boot now!
